Note to users of Snap! Jr. :

Welcome! If you don't know, COPPA stands for Children's Online Privacy Protection Act. It is issued by the US government and we must comply with it. To make it easier for us please follow these rules:

NOTE: These rules only apply if your under 13 in the US. If you live somewhere else you are responsible for following the regulations of your country.

  1. Get parent or guardian to enter their email when signing up.
  2. Do not post any personal information (

This is what personal information is.

  • First and last name;
  • A home or other physical address including street name and name of a city or town;
  • Online contact information;
  • A screen or user name that functions as online contact information;
  • A telephone number;
  • A Social Security number;
  • A persistent identifier that can be used to recognize a user over time and across different websites or online services;
  • A photograph, video, or audio file, where such file contains a child’s image or voice;
  • Geolocation information sufficient to identify street name and name of a city or town; or
  • Information concerning the child or the parents of that child that the operator collects online from the child and combines with an identifier described above.
